### Step 4: Swap assignment backends

Splitjar now resolves experiment assignments from the new bucketing service instead of the legacy hash table. Reviewers should confirm that callers pass the unit key explicitly and that sticky assignments survive the swap in the shadow logs. The cutover requires updating the service to the values listed below.

settings of tagef-bawif:
DRUIX_HOST=druix.zemvarlabs.internal
DRUIX_PORT=8000

**Mgmt Meeting Minutes — Retiring the Brightline Range**

Quick recap for sales leads at Fenholt Supplies: we agreed to retire the Brightline fixture range by year-end. Remaining stock moves to clearance pricing next month, and accounts on standing orders get migrated to the Lumetta range. Trade-in incentives were approved in principle. The confidential note on next steps sits just below.

board note of bajof-bajeg: The pricing group signed off on a budget of $13.4 million for Project Sildor. The renewal with Lamixek Holdings closes at $48.9 million a year, 49 percent above the last contract.

## Runbook: connection pooling (Tarnwick)

Pool size fixed at 40 per node. Do not raise without DBA sign-off; Tarnwick's primary caps at 500 connections total. On deploy, drain pools, restart, verify no connection storms in the first five minutes. Pooler config is signed; the agent rejects unsigned configs. Rotate quarterly. The key currently used to sign pooler configs follows.

signing key of yajog-kafof = bky19_orbYRY3Abj3KpZesMie